#010cdb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#010cdb is composed of 0.4% red, 4.7%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 94.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 237 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.1%. #010cdb color hex could be obtained by blending #0218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#010cdb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000004 is the darkest color, while #f0f0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#010cdb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676775 is the less saturated color, while #010cdb is the most saturated one.
